Php büyük küçük büyük harf dönüştürme

        Büyük harfleri küçük , küçük harfleri büyük harfe dönüştürmeyi , sadece ilk harfleri küçük harfe dönüştürme işlemleri yapalım.Veri tabanından çekilen veri web sayfasınının farklı yerlerinde büyük ya da küçük harfle kullanılabilir . bunun için harf dönüştürme işlemi yapılır.Harf dönüştürme fonksiyonları direkt olarak kullanılırsa Türkçe karakter sorunu ortaya çıkar.Bu yüzden fonksiyon içinde kullanılırlar.

Küçük harfleri büyük harfe çevirme . . .

strtoupper() fonksiyonu küçük harfleri büyük harfe çevirir.

Örnek :

– Kodlar – <?php
echo strtoupper(“Mobil Bilişim , Web Dizayn , Animasyon Dersleri . . .”);
?>

 

– Prrogram Çıktısı – MOBIL BILIşIM , WEB DIZAYN , ANIMASYON DERSLERI . .

Yukarıda görüldüğü gibi strtoupper() fonksiyonu büyültme işlemi yapar.Fakat Türkçe karakter problemi ortaya çıkmaktadır.Bunu aşmak için fonksiyon tanımlanır ve Türkçe karakterler diziye aktarılır.

– Kodlar – <?php
function buyut($metin) {
$kucuk=array(‘ı’,’i’,’ş’,’ö’,’ğ’,’ç’,’ü’);
$buyuk=array(‘I’,’İ’,’Ş’,’Ö’,’Ğ’,’Ç’,’Ü’);
$metin=str_replace($kucuk,$buyuk,$metin);
$metin = strtoupper($metin);
return $metin;
}
echo buyut(“Mobil Bilişim , Web Dizayn , Animasyon Dersleri . . .”);
?>

 

– Program Çıktısı – MOBİL BİLİŞİM , WEB DİZAYN , ANİMASYON DERSLERİ . . .

str_replace ( ) fonksiyonu ne işe yarar ?

Bir cümle içerisindeki bulunan bazı karakterleri/kelimeleri istenilen karakterlerle değiştirmeyi sağlar.

– Kodlar – <?php
$ne_iceyim =”Her gün sigara ve alkol içebilirsin.”;
$tavsiye_etmem=array(“sigara”,”alkol”);
$saglik=array(“kefir”,”limonata”);
echo str_replace($tavsiye_etmem,$saglik,$ne_iceyim);
?>

 

– Program Çıktısı – Her gün kefir ve limonata içebilirsin.

Büyük harfleri küçük harfe çevirme . . .

strtolower( ) fonksiyonu büyük harfleri küçük harflaere çevirir.Aynı şekilde Türkçe karakterler problemi vardır.Bunu aşmak için fonksiyon tanımlanır ve Türkçe karakterler diziye aktarılır.

– Kodlar – <?php
function kucult($metin) {
$kucuk=array(‘ı’,’i’,’ş’,’ö’,’ğ’,’ç’,’ü’);
$buyuk=array(‘I’,’İ’,’Ş’,’Ö’,’Ğ’,’Ç’,’Ü’);
$metin=str_replace($buyuk,$kucuk,$metin);
$metin= strtolower($metin);
return $metin;
}
echo kucult(“MOBİL BİLİŞİM , WEB DİZAYN , ANİMASYON DERSLERİ . . .”);
?>

 

– Program Çıktısı – mobil bilişim , web dizayn , animasyon dersleri . . .

Büyük harfleri küçük harfe çevirme . . .

strtolower( ) fonksiyonu büyük harfleri küçük harflaere çevirir.Aynı şekilde Türkçe karakterler problemi vardır.Bunu aşmak için fonksiyon tanımlanır ve Türkçe karakterler diziye aktarılır.

 

– Kodlar – <?php
function kucult($metin) {
$kucuk=array(‘ı’,’i’,’ş’,’ö’,’ğ’,’ç’,’ü’);
$buyuk=array(‘I’,’İ’,’Ş’,’Ö’,’Ğ’,’Ç’,’Ü’);
$metin=str_replace($buyuk,$kucuk,$metin);
$metin= strtolower($metin);
return $metin;
}
echo kucult(“MOBİL BİLİŞİM , WEB DİZAYN , ANİMASYON DERSLERİ . . .”);
?>

 

– Program Çıktısı – mobil bilişim , web dizayn , animasyon dersleri . . .

 

Paylaş:

Bir cevap yazın

E-posta hesabınız yayımlanmayacak. Gerekli alanlar * ile işaretlenmişlerdir